Choosing the Right Contractor for your Vessel
At Marlborough Sounds Marinas, we’re committed to protecting not only your boat but the boats of all our valued customers. When work is carried out in our marinas and, it’s essential that it is done safely, professionally, and with care for our environment.
For this reason, as per our marina rules, only Registered Contractors who have completed our induction process are permitted to operate in Picton, Waikawa and/or Havelock marinas, as well as on the Hardstand at our Waikawa Marine Centre. This ensures that everyone working onsite understands our health, safety, and environmental standards.

The Importance of the Right Insurance
Marine work carries unique risks, so we require all Registered Contractors to hold current Public Liability Insurance and Marine Trades or Ship Repairer’s Liability Insurance.
Public Liability Insurance typically covers:
- Damage caused to marina property or other boats
- Accidental injury to third parties while work is being carried out
- Costs associated with accidental spills or environmental damage
Ship Repairers Liability Insurance typically covers:
- Damage to a vessel while it is being repaired or serviced
- Losses arising from errors in workmanship
- Accidental damage to tools, equipment, or nearby property during marine repair activities
Engaging a contractor with the correct insurance protects you, your vessel, and your finances. In the unlikely event that something goes wrong, their insurance ensures issues can be resolved professionally, safely, and without leaving you exposed to unexpected costs.
